What’s On the Table:

  • Patty’s Pulled Pork Sliders — smoked slow, wrapped in banana leaf
  • The Luau Mac Salad — creamy cavatappi with ham, red peppers, and our secret rub
  • Paddy’s Prime Tips — marinated steak tips grilled to perfection
  • Island Shrimp Skewers — sweet heat shrimp kissed by the flame
  • Paddy’s Pineapple Fried Rice — wok-fired and pineapple-packed
  • Mango Salad Dressing — bright, sweet, and tangy for any salad
